Transaction 05bf7478bd1179f4bfa3a35ecd72f4e197b4acd087ee06981eecca41aca989cb

1 Input
1 Outputs
  • 05bf7478bd1179f4bfa3a35ecd72f4e197b4acd087ee06981eecca41aca989cb:0
  • value  2886375
    address  3MvWu6RePCM8FDLspKi1EANoX9C2hT5eUv